وب سایت اولین جایی است که مخاطب شما اولین برداشت ها را از کسب و کار شما دریافت میکند،- و این فقط در طراحی و محتوای وب سایت خلاصه نمیشود. علاوه بر این ها، بهینه سازی سرعت یکی از مهم ترین عوامل تعیین کننده موفقیت وب سایت شما است. یک وب سایت با کند که زمان بارگذاری در آن بالا است می تواند به اعتبار شما آسیب برساند و باعث از دست رفتن ترافیک و نرخ جذب مشتری برای شما شود و در نهایت هزینه های بیشتری را به شما تحمیل کند. برعکس، یک وب سایت با کارایی بالا تأثیر مثبت و دومینو واری بر موفقیت کسب و کار شما خواهد داشت. بازدیدکنندگان بیشتری را جذب می کند و به نوبه خود باعث افزایش فروش و جذب مشتریان بیشتر می شود.
اولین قدم برای اطمینان از داشتن یک سایت با بارگذاری سریع این است که وب سایت خود را با استفاده از یک سازنده وب سایت قوی ایجاد کنید، که فناوری بهینه شده را از همان ابتدا به کار گیرد. با این حال، پس از این کار تمام نشده است، این دست شماست که مطمئن شوید محتوای سایت شما مانع عملکرد آن نمی شود.
عوامل زیادی را میتوان در نظر گرفت، و در این مقاله هر آنچه را که باید در مورد بهینه سازی سرعت وب سایت و چگونگی بهبود سرعت صفحه سایت خود بدانید در اختیار شما قرار می دهیم.
سرعت صفحه چیست؟
سرعت صفحه به سرعت بارگذاری محتوای صفحه وب شما اشاره دارد. راههای زیادی برای اندازهگیری این موضوع وجود دارد (به عنوان مثال، از اولین رنگ محتوا (first contentful paint)، تا شاخص سرعت، تا رنگ پر محتوا (large contentful paint)) - اما یکی از معنیدارترین راهها برای تعریف سرعت صفحه، زمان تعامل (time to interactive) است. Time to interactive عبارت است از مدت زمانی که طول می کشد تا یک صفحه تا جایی بارگذاری شود که کاربر بتواند با آن تعامل داشته باشد. این ممکن است به معنای کلیک کردن روی یک CTA، انتخاب پخشی از یک ویدیو یا هر تعداد از اقداماتی باشد که کاربر میتواند در یک صفحه خاص انجام دهد.
سؤال بعدی احتمالاً این است که «سرعت خوب وب سایت چیست؟» با این که پاسخ به سؤال مربوط به صنعت است، ولی توصیه اصلی این است که به طور متوسط، صفحات باید در کمتر از سه ثانیه بارگیری شوند. همچنین باید به یاد داشته باشید که زمان سرعت صفحه می تواند در صفحات مختلف یک سایت و همچنین در تلفن همراه و دسکتاپ متفاوت باشد.
از نسخه ۱۰ به بعد نرم افزارن Lighthouse، زمان متریک تعاملی به عنوان معیار بارگذاری صفحه حذف شده است. علت هم ابن بوده که LCP، Index Speed و Total Blocking Time شاخصهای بهتری برای تجربه کاربر در نظر گرفته میشوند.
چرا سرعت صفحه مهم است؟
چهار دلیل اصلی وجود دارد که به سرعت صفحه در بهینه سازی سرعت وب سایت اهمیت میدهد:
قابلیت استفاده
ممکن است واضح به نظر برسد، اما هرچه صفحات شما سریعتر بارگذاری شوند، با وب سایت زودتر می توان تعامل داشت. منظور ما بارگیری مواردی مانند منوی وب سایت، محتوای بصری، دکمه ها و موارد دیگر است که به بازدیدکنندگان کمک می کند تا در سایت شما فعالیتی را انجام دهند. با بهینهسازی سرعت صفحه، امکان مشاهده و استفاده سریعتر این ویژگیها باعث ایجاد بازدیدکنندگان راضیتر و بازگرداندن آن ها میشود؛ به همین سادگی.
تجربه ی کاربر
زمانی که کاربران بتوانند سریعتر فرآیندها را طی کنند، احتمالاً با وب سایت شما ارتباط بهتری برقرار میکنند. برای مثال، اگر در فروشگاه آنلاین شما، بارگیری هر مرحله از فرآیند پرداخت بیش از چند ثانیه طول بکشد، اگر خریدار به کلی از خرید منصرف شود این مسؤله قابل درک است. همین امر در مورد هر اقدامی که کاربر سعی می کند انجام دهد، مانند پر کردن فرم ها یا حرکت بین صفحات نیز صدق می کند. مشکلات سرعت وبسایت که تعامل کاربر را محدود میکند، بر نرخ جذب مشتری و تعداد بازدیدکنندگانی که به سایت شما باز میگردند، تأثیر منفی میگذارد.
نرخ جذب مشتری
یکی از اهداف مشترک اکثر صاحبان سایت، تبدیل است. مطالعات نشان می دهد که حتی 0.1 ثانیه بهبود در سرعت وب سایت شما می تواند تأثیر مثبتی بر نرخ تبدیل، پیشرفت قیف و تعامل مشتری داشته باشد. اگر بازدیدکنندگان نتوانند از ویژگی های شما به اندازه کافی سریع استفاده کنند، به سراغ بعدی خواهند رفت.
موتورهای جستجو
گوگل هنگام رتبهبندی سایتها، سرعت وبسایت و تجربه کاربر را در نظر میگیرد. بنابراین، اگر میخواهید صفحه شما در نتایج جستجوی کلمات کلیدی خاص بالاتر به نظر برسد، برای هر میلیثانیه سریعتر که صفحات شما برای چشم قابل مشاهده هستند، شانس بیشتری خواهید داشت.
نحوه اندازه گیری سرعت صفحه
روش های مختلفی برای اندازه گیری سرعت صفحه در وب سایت وجود دارد. یکی از مطمئن ترین و محبوب ترین روش ها استفاده از Google PageSpeed Insights است که در آن می توانید به سادگی آدرس سایت خود را وارد کنید و منتظر بمانید تا گوگل گزارشی از عملکرد سایت شما ارائه دهد. این گزارش حاوی تعدادی معیار یا Core Web Vitals است که Google آنها را بهعنوان یکی دیگر از عوامل رتبهبندی بالقوه برای تعیین رتبهبندی یک صفحه در نتایج جستجوی خود در نظر میگیرد. یک امتیاز خوب ( که با رنگ سبز نشان داده می شود) ممکن است برای رتبهبندی کلی و موردی سایت شما مفید باشد. رتبه بندی صفحات در جستجو امتیاز پایین یا هشدار دهنده ( با رنگ قرمز ) ممکن است بر رتبه بندی کلی و موردی سایت شما تأثیر منفی بگذارد.
در آپریل 2023، گوگل اعلام کرد تجربه صفحه، سرعت صفحه، سازگاری با موبایل و امنیت سایت، «سیگنالهای» رتبهبندی هستند که نباید با رتبهبندی «سیستمها» اشتباه گرفته شوند. این بیانیه پس از آن منتشر شد که گوگل مستندات راهنما خود را به روز کرد و تجربه صفحه را به عنوان یک سیستم حذف کرد. در حالی که سیگنالهای بالا هنوز مهم هستند، جان مولر خاطرنشان میکند که این تغییرات به این دلیل است که «ما دیدهایم که مردم بیش از حد روی این اعداد تمرکز میکنند، این استفاده خوبی از زمان و انرژی نیست.»
Google PageSpeed Insights عملکرد کلی سرعت سایت شما را با استفاده از امتیازی با سقف 100 رتبه بندی می کند. امتیاز بین 90 تا 100 بهینه در نظر گرفته می شود، در حالی که هر چیزی کمتر از نمره 59 به عنوان یک هشدار در نظر گرفته می شود و باید شما را وادار کند تا بهینه سازی سرعت وب سایت خود را در اولویت قرار دهید.
عملکرد ما در آپکدرز نشان داده که سایت های طراحی شده توسط ما، گوگل را راضی نگاه داشته است. ما عملکرد و بهینه سازی را در اولویت قرار می دهیم.
استفاده از ابزارهای مختلف تست عملکرد برای اندازه گیری سرعت صفحه همواره به نمرات متفاوتی منجر می شود. هر پلتفرم تجزیه و تحلیل و داده های خود را به روش های مختلف جمع آوری می کند و این می تواند بر امتیاز سرعت صفحه شما در هر زمان معین تأثیر بگذارد. با این حال، آنچه که بسیار مهم است، مراحلی است که می توانید برای بهبود امتیاز خود بردارید که در زیر به آنها خواهیم پرداخت.
نحوه بهبود سرعت صفحه (و تجربه کاربری خود)
به طور کلی، اگر چارچوب و فریمورک مناسبی برای طراحی وب سایت انتخاب شده باشد، بسیاری از مراحل لازم برای بهبود سرعت صفحه و عملکرد وب سایت به صورت پیش فرض اجرا خواهد شد. تنها کاری که باید انجام دهید این است که هر از چند گاهی بر روی اندازه گیری سرعت صفحه خود تمرکز کنید و در عین حال تأثیر طراحی و محتوای خود را بر عملکرد وب سایت خود بررسی کنید. در ادامه، یاد خواهید گرفت که چگونه می توانید عملکرد وب سایت و سرعت صفحه را افزایش دهید تا مطمئن شوید که مشتریان و هم چنین موتور جستجوی Google راضی هستند. همچنین نکات مفیدی را گنجاندهایم که میتوانید از آنها برای بهینهسازی سرعت وبسایت خود استفاده کنید.
۰۱. بهینه سازی فایل ها
تصاویر بزرگ می توانند مانع بزرگی برای بهبود سرعت صفحه باشند. کیفیت تصویر مهم است - اما باید توازنی بین عملکرد و کیفیت (حجم) تصویر برقرار کرد. برای انجام این کار، چند راه وجود دارد که می توانید تصاویر را فشرده کنید.
هنگام ساخت یک وب سایت، تغییر رویکرد شما برای ذخیره تصاویر می تواند تأثیر مثبتی بر سرعت بارگذاری صفحه سایت شما داشته باشد. برخی از بهترین روشهایی که میتوانید در سایت خود به کار ببرید عبارتند از: ذخیره تصاویر بهعنوان JPG به جای PNG (فایلهای JPG کوچکتر هستند و در نتیجه سریعتر بارگذاری میشوند)، استفاده از فایلهای SVG در صورت امکان (که حتی کوچکتر هستند و برای اشکال یا لوگوها به خوبی کار میکنند)، و در نهایت ، تصاویر بزرگتر را بیشتر در پایین صفحه قرار دهید تا زمانی که کاربران روی محتوای بالای صفحه شما تمرکز می کنند، زمان بارگذاری داشته باشند.
هیچ چیز به اندازه گیف های متحرک باعث ایجاد کندی در صفحه نمی شود - تصاویر گیف خیلی جذاب هستند - اما هیچ چیزی هم وجود ندارد که سرعت صفحه را بیشتر از این تصاویر کُند کند. بنابراین قبل از استفاده از آنها همه جوانب را بسنجید و در صورت لزوم آنها را در پایین صفحه خود قرار دهید. محدود کردن تعداد فریمهایی که انیمیشن شما دارد و کوچک نگه داشتن ابعاد آن نیز میتواند تاثیر ویژگیهای طراحی بر امتیازات سرعت صفحه شما را متوقف کند.
یکی دیگر از نکات مهم برای بهینهسازی سرعت وبسایت (اگر واقعاً باید از انیمیشن در سایت استفاده کنید) این است که به جای انیمیشن از ویدیو استفاده کنید، زیرا از اندازه فایلهای کوچکتری نسبت به انیمیشنها دارد. گاهی اوقات داشتن یک وب سایت ساده بهتر است و کارشناسان تاکید می کنند که وب سایت های ساده بیشتر موفق هستند. یکی از سادهترین راهها برای بهبود عملکرد وبسایت، کاهش پیچیدگی سایت است. این سادگی از طراحی و تصاویر وب سایت شروع می شود و به تجربه کاربری و دیگر قسمت های سایت تسری مییابد.
۰۲. ساده سازی کد
کدهای پیچیده یا کدهایی که به درستی قالب بندی نشده اند، می توانند سرعت صفحه را کاهش دهند. استفاده از کد سادهشده، خزیدن سایت شما را برای Google آسانتر میکند، و همچنین بارگذاری سریع صفحات را آسانتر میکند (هر چیزی که زندگی Google را آسانتر کند، یک پیروزی برای وبسایت شماست). برنامه نویسی را انتخاب کنید که از کدهای ساده شده در تمام صفحات خود استفاده کند تا دیگر نگران بررسی یا تمیز کردن آن نباشید و مطمئن باشید صفحات شما برای عملکرد بهینه شده اند.
۰۳. استفاده از CDN
CDN (شبکه توزیع محتوا) به سرورها و مراکز داده ای اطلاق می شود که در مکان های جغرافیایی مختلف قرار گرفته اند و سپس محتوا را به وب سایت های منطقه خود تحویل می دهند. این باعث افزایش زمان تحویل محتوا و در نتیجه کاهش زمان بارگذاری می شود.
۰۴. استفاده از بارگذاری تنبل (Lazy Load)
لود تنبل به معنای تاخیر در بارگذاری محتوای وب سایت یا رسانه ای است که خارج از دید اولیه کاربر است. این به طور خودکار برای بسیاری از سازندگان وب سایت اتفاق می افتد، که اغلب بارگذاری تنبل را در تمام صفحه خود اعمال می کنند. همچنین میتوانید نقش خود را با قرار دادن عناصر با وضوح بزرگتر یا بالاتر در پایین صفحه خود انجام دهید، و به آنها زمان بدهید تا قبل از اینکه کاربران به پایین اسکرول کنند، بارگذاری شوند. به دقت فکر کنید که چه چیزی ابتدا در هر صفحه معینی از وب سایت شما بارگیری می شود. اولویت را بالاتر از محتوای فولد قرار دهید، زیرا این همان چیزی است که کاربران در اولین بازدید از سایت شما می بینند. شما باید سعی کنید آن را ساده، اما تاثیرگذار نگه دارید و از آن به عنوان راهی برای نگه داشتن بازدیدکنندگان در حین بارگذاری بقیه صفحه استفاده کنید.
۰۵. اجتناب از افزونه ها
افزودن تجزیه و تحلیل شخص ثالث، کدهای ردیابی و پلاگین ها به سایت شما می تواند واقعاً سرعت صفحه را کاهش دهد. به همین خاطر باید چارچوبی را انتخاب کنید که همه اینها را در خود داشته باشد. به این ترتیب شما از این نکته ظریف - اغلب پیچیده - بین جمعآوری هرچه بیشتر دادههای رفتار کاربر اجتناب میکنید و در عین حال سرعت را بهینه میکنید.
هنوز به اطلاعات بیشتری در مورد کاربران و عملکرد سایت خود نیاز دارید؟ توصیه میکنیم استفاده از افزونهها و کدهای رهگیری را در اولویت قرار دهید که بر تجزیه و تحلیل نحوه تعامل کاربران با سایت شما تمرکز میکنند، زیرا بازخورد معنیداری در مورد عملکرد آن به شما میدهند. همچنین می توان سرعت و عملکرد صفحه سایت خود را با و بدون افزونه ها و پیکسل های ردیابی اضافه شده ارزیابی کرد تا به طور کامل متوجه شوید که آیا آنها سرعت صفحه را مختل می کنند یا خیر.
۰۶. اول موبایل
اطمینان از اینکه کاربران و موتورهای جستجو دارای بهترین تجربه ممکن برای موبایل هستند برای بهینه سازی عملکرد وب سایت شما بسیار مهم است و باید بخشی جدایی ناپذیر از چک لیست راه اندازی وب سایت شما باشد. ما می دانیم که Google ابتدا برای تلفن همراه خزیده می شود و کاربران به طور فزاینده ای در دستگاه های تلفن همراه مرور می کنند. بنابراین وقتی صحبت از بهینه سازی سرعت صفحه می شود، وب سایت موبایل شما باید در اولویت باشد.
۰۷. استقرار کش
ذخیره خودکار به این معنی است که بخشی از محتوای سایت شما همانطور که در ابتدا توسط کاربر مشاهده می شود ذخیره می شود و هنگام بازدید مجدد دقیقاً به همان روش نمایش داده می شود. این یک جنبه مهم برای بهبود سرعت صفحه و تجربه کاربر است، زیرا با ارائه محتوای ذخیره شده زمان بارگذاری را برای کاربران تکراری یک سایت کاهش می دهد.
۰۸. بهینه سازی محتوا
بهینه سازی محتوا می تواند معانی زیادی داشته باشد. در اینجا ما به آن در زمینه نحوه نمایش محتوا در صفحه خود به گونه ای اشاره می کنیم که سرعت صفحه تحت تأثیر قرار نگیرد. یک مثال عالی از بهینه سازی محتوا به نام بهبود سرعت وب سایت، داشتن پخش کننده ویدیویی داخلی در سایت است. این به شما امکان می دهد بدون اتکا به منبع خارجی، مانند جاسازی یک ویدیوی در آپارات، ویدیوها را در صفحات خود نمایش دهید، که می تواند تأثیر واقعی و زیادی بر سرعت صفحه شما داشته باشد. ویژگیهای داخلی مانند این، طراحی سایت مبتنی بر عملکرد را آسانتر میکند.
همچنین از تعداد فونت های وب سایت خود و اندازه آنها آگاه باشید. هرچه تعداد تایپفیسهای بیشتری استفاده کنید و تنوع رنگ و اندازه بیشتری داشته باشید، صفحه شما کندتر بارگذاری میشود. چند گزینه را انتخاب کنید که تأثیرگذار باشند و به آنها پای بند باشید. این چیزی است که باید از آن آگاه بود، چه در حال ساختن یک وب سایت از ابتدا باشید، چه به سادگی یک وب سایت فعلی را برای بهبود سرعت صفحه آن بهینه کنید.
سوالات متداول بهینه سازی سرعت وب سایت
چگونه سرعت وب سایت خود را بهینه کنم؟
تعدادی کار وجود دارد که می توانید انجام دهید، بسته به اینکه سایت شما چگونه ساخته شده است و بر روی چه چارچوبی وب سایت ساخته شده است. نکات عمومی بهینه سازی سرعت وب سایت شامل فشرده سازی تصاویر، استفاده از CDN، به حداقل رساندن کد، کاهش درخواست های HTTP، استفاده از کش مرورگر و میزبانی سریع و قابل اعتماد است.
چرا بهینه سازی سرعت وب سایت مهم است؟
بهینه سازی سرعت وب سایت برای اطمینان از بارگیری سریع وب سایت شما برای کاربران مهم است. این تجربه کاربر را بهبود می بخشد و باعث می شود آنها در سایت شما تبدیل شوند و به آن بازگردند. بهبود سرعت وب سایت همچنین عملکرد تلفن همراه سایت شما را بهبود می بخشد. در یک فضای آنلاین رقابتی، یک وب سایت سریعتر می تواند تفاوت در نحوه درک کاربران از برند و پیشنهادات شما ایجاد کند.
سرعت صفحه چگونه بر سئو تاثیر می گذارد؟
گوگل در سال ۲۰۱۸ اعلام کرد که سرعت صفحه می تواند یک عامل رتبه بندی در نظر گرفته شود. با این حال در سال ۲۰۲۳ این تغییر کرده است - و این فقط بخشی از سیگنال رتبه بندی گسترده تر است که به عنوان تجربه صفحه شناخته می شود. سرعت صفحه شما می تواند بر سلامت سایت شما تأثیر بگذارد و این می تواند بر تلاش های سئو شما نیز تأثیر بگذارد.